Job Description

Title: Product Owner

Duration: Full Time

Eligibility: Candidates with unrestricted work authorization only.

Client : Leading provider of managed care services within the workers' compensation industry.

Position Overview: We are seeking a dynamic and results-driven Product Owner / Project Manager to join the team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in medical billing review and insurance, along with excellent project management skills. This role will be critical in guiding product development, managing project timelines, and ensuring alignment with business objectives.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Serve as the primary liaison between stakeholders, including business units and development teams, to define product vision and requirements.
  • Develop and prioritize product backlog based on stakeholder feedback, business needs, and market trends.
  • Manage the full project lifecycle, from planning and execution to delivery and post-launch analysis.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ure timely and successful product releases.
  • Analyze and interpret data related to medical billing processes, providing insights that inform product enhancements.
  • Create and maintain project documentation, including project plans, status reports, and risk assessments.
  • Facilitate meetings, workshops, and presentations to communicate project updates and gather feedback from stakeholders.
  • Monitor industry trends and regulatory changes related to medical billing and insurance to inform product strategies.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or s degree or higher in Business Administration, Project Management, Healthcare Administration, or a related field.
  • 5+ years of experience in project management, with a focus on product ownership in healthcare or insurance.
  • Strong understanding of medical billing processes and insurance operations.
  • Proven experience with Agile methodologies and project management tools (e.g., JIRA or similar).
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to engage and influence stakeholders at all levels.
  • Strong analytical skills with a data-driven approach to decision-making.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a hybrid work environment.
